Network Science Course

Instructor: Carlos Castillo

These are materials for an undergraduate course on Network Science, and include two-hour lectures and two-hour practice sessions every week. They were developed for second year students of the bachelor degree on Mathematical Engineering on Data Science at Universitat Pompeu Fabra, Barcelona.

Contents of this repository

🚧 These materials should not be considered final until the end of the course.

  • 📈 Theory: slides for the theory part.
  • 💻 Practicum: activities for practical sessions.
  • 📁 Datasets: to be used during practical sessions.
  • 📝 Exams from previous and current year.

Acknowledgments

The course, particularly the first half, follows the book and course on complex networks by Albert-László Barabási.

I am thankful to the course's teaching assistants Fedor Vityugin (2020), Alexander Gomez (2018-2020) and Alexandra Matreata (2018) at UPF, and the feedback from Vicenç Gómez on an early version of this course.

Course materials are available under a Creative Commons license unless specified otherwise.
